
How to watch Saturday’s FA Cup matches: Kick-off times, live streams and more
The FA Cup has returned with the first set of fourth round ties already reaching their conclusion on Friday.
Both Chelsea and Wrexham progressed into the fifth round, overcoming Hull City and Ipswich Town, respectively.
However, there are plenty of fixtures set to go ahead on Saturday, as multiple teams look to win the FA Cup.
The likes of Man City, Liverpool and Aston Villa are all in action as they look to avoid an early exit.
Now, Football Insider has examined which matches are available to watch on Saturday in the UK.

Which matches are on TV in the FA Cup fourth round on Saturday?
West Ham’s away tie against Burton Albion is the first match that is set to be shown on TV in the UK.
Nuno Espirito’s side travel to the Pirelli Stadium for the lunchtime match, which is set to kick-off at 12:15pm.
The game will be shown live via TNT Sports 1 and discovery+ as the Hammers look to avoid an upset against the League One side.
Following the 3pm matches, the next game on TV is Aston Villa’s home match against Newcastle United.
Unai Emery’s side will take on the Magpies at Villa Park, with kick-off at 5:45pm.

This tie will be available through multiple broadcasters, with it set to be shown live on BBC One, iPlayer, TNT Sports 3 and discovery+.
The final match on TV is Liverpool’s match against Brighton & Hove Albion at Anfield.
Kick-off for the fourth round tie is at 8pm, with TNT Sports 1 and discovery+ showing the fixture.
When is the fifth round draw for the FA Cup?
The fifth round draw of the FA Cup will be made on Monday, before Macclesfield take on Brentford in the final tie of the fourth round.
Fans will be able to watch the draw on TNT Sports 1, discovery+ and on the TNT Sports YouTube channel.
This will begin at 6:35pm, during the tie’s pre-match coverage for the Macclesfield against Brentford match.
The fifth round of the Emirates FA Cup will be played around the weekend of Saturday 7 and Sunday 8 March 2026.
It remains to be seen who is able to join Chelsea and Wrexham in the draw for the fifth round as multiple sides aim to progress far in this year’s edition of the competition.
